Shooting Sports places second in multiple events at SASP Ohio Regional

MARENGO, Ohio – Concordia Wisconsin's first-ever competition ended with much success, as they finished second in the Rimfire Pistol, Iron Rifle and Optic Rifle events on Saturday during the SASP Ohio Regional at Cardinal Shooting Center.

The Falcons newly formed club sport took three shooters and turned in second place finishes in three different events. They had practiced just a few times and were already successful against other collegiate programs from around the country.

Mikaela Leach shined in all three events, as she was the leader for the Falcons in the Rimfire Pistol (94.30 seconds), Optics Rifle (77.07 seconds) and Iron Rifle (59.71 seconds). As well, Andrew Handrich was second on the squad in all three events – Rimfire Pistol (71.83 seconds), Optics Rifle (53.14 seconds) and Iron Rifle (54.81 seconds). Grant Steinike rounded out the lineup with times of 103.78 in Rimfire Pistol, 51.48 during the Optics Rifle and 56.82 when shooting in the Iron Rifle event.

The Falcons finished second in all three Collegiate Open events as a team. Also competing were members from UW-Platteville, Bethel, Miami (Ohio) and Michigan State. The weather conditions weren't favorable, as the temperature was in the upper 30s with snow, sleet and rain falling to make things difficult on the shooters.

Concordia Wisconsin will next travel to Talladega, Ala., for the SSSF College Nationals at CMP Talladega Marksmanship Park on March 11-12.
